INTERNAL MEMO — MARKETING BUDGET

Team,

Heads-up for all branch managers: the Q3 marketing budget is being trimmed by roughly 15%. The Lanebrook campaign wraps as planned, but local print spend and the Torvale sponsorship are paused. Digital spend stays intact, so keep your regional pushes running there. Please resubmit revised branch plans by the 20th — keep them lean, and flag anything you genuinely can't cut. This isn't about performance; it's about freeing up cash for something bigger. Details are in the confidential note below.

board note of kageg-bahof: The renewal with Holwynax Holdings closes at $2 million a year, 5 percent below the last contract. Project Ulaath slips by two quarters because of the supplier delay.

- [ ] Plugin authors: before the key ceremony for Driftgate's canary gating rules, confirm your plugin's health-check endpoint passes the staged rollout probe — gating will block promotion otherwise. Once everyone's signed off, we seal the gating-policy signing key into escrow. Should the escrow ever need to be cracked open to rotate the key, use the recovery passphrase recorded on the line below.

vault phrase of hahop-badug = novvan-ulaion-zorius-noviel-gorwyn-casix-tamys

## Local Setup — Template Rendering Benchmarks

Quartzleaf's rendering benchmarks measure how quickly the Emberline template engine compiles and renders our catalog pages. Install dependencies with `make bootstrap`, then run `bench/run.sh` to produce baseline timings. Results are written to a local metrics database so you can compare runs over time; do not commit these files. Before your first run, configure the metrics store by exporting the connection string shown below.

warehouse DSN: clickhouse://druys_svc:Pl@db-47e1.orvexstack.corp:5432/beldor